Study On The Positive Frequency Of Glutamic Acid Decarboxylase Antibody In Newly-diagnosed Type 2 Diabetic Patients And Clinical Characteristics In Patients With Positive Antibody

Objective: To investigate the positive frequency of glutamic acid decarboxylase antibody(GAD-Ab) in newly-diagnosed type 2 diabetic patients(T2DM) and analyze the clinical characteristics in patients with positive antibody.Methods: 126 newly-diagnosed T2DM patients were enrolled into measurement of GAD-Ab with radioligand assay and analyse the clinical characteristics of the GAD-Ab positive patients .Results: 1.The positive frequency of GAD-Ab in 126 newly-diagnosed T2DM patients was 7.1 % (9/126). the age of onset of which newly-diagnosed T2DM patients with the GAD-Ab positive is 32~52 years old , their BMI is 18.58~27.92 kg/m~2, their WHR is 0.84~0.98. The clinical characteristics of GAD-Ab positive patients compare withGAD-Ab negative group,it indicates that in GAD-Ab positive group patients are younger age (44.±5.7years vs 46.9 ± 11.58 years),and their BMI(22.27±3.21 vs 24.50± 3.47),and WHR(0.89 ± 0.05 vs 0.91 ± 0.06) are lower.Conclusions: The positive frequency of GAD-Ab in newly-diagnosed T2DM in our study are 7.1% . Type 2 diabetes with GAD-Ab positive have younger age at onset, lower BMI and WHR.
